Brother's focus on social responsibility and business flexibility for customer engagement

The company is also helping communities in developing countries to regenerate forests.

On its third decade of operations in Singapore, Brother is stepping up its efforts in corporate social responsibility through Brother Earth, a programme that embodies the  company’s community and environmental contributions. This programme encourages customers to trade in used printer ink and toner cartridges for recycling at no cost. They receive a special price or shopping vouchers when they bring in their old printers or used cartridges.

Brother is also facilitating public engagement through “Click for the Earth,” an online facility where people can sign up and contribute towards environmental conservation activities. For every click made on the BrotherEarth.com website, the company will donate 1 yen (approximately US 1 cent) to support activities aimed at stopping desertification and regenerating forests in countries such as Peru, Guatemala and Thailand.

The benefits of Click Charge and BroCare
Customers with a copier contract who want to shorten or customise their plan can do so through Brother’s Click Charge programme. The programme allows enhanced control over the customer’s printing operations by providing regular preventive maintenance and professional tracking reports. Some of its features include free installation and machine setup, a new business multifunction centre (MFC-L6900DWT), periodic maintenance to ensure maximum efficiency, toner and drum delivery on demand, monitoring and reporting of printing usage, warranty coverage of parts and labour, and low cost of $0.01 per page print.

To further help businesses work smarter, BroCare offers an enhanced service package that provides additional coverage. Realising that a standard warranty may not be enough for the use of certain enterprises, Brother offers an after-sales service that ensures quality support from the company’s team of professional engineers. BroCare includes specific packages for the PR series (embroidery machines) and for printers and multifunction equipment. The result is a hassle-free and convenient business operation that ensures peace of mind for everyone involved.

Towards growth and maximum efficiency
Another important initiative in Singapore is Brother’s Commercial Embroidery Machine Seminar, where interested parties can test bed their own embroidery business by using the company’s semi-industrial machines. The purpose of this seminar is to show business owners what they can do with the machines and when they can start to earn profit by customising various products such as apparel, accessories, and towels, encouraging them to give a personal touch to their products and services. For instance, a luxury hotel in Singapore has acquired a Brother embroidery machine to specifically sew customers’ initials on pillowcases and towels.

Brother knows that managing business transformation and controlling cost overheads are essential to the success of organisations. That’s why it has introduced BroPlan, a new print solutions concept that consists of strategically crafted packages that are suited to each customer’s environment—particularly for SMEs and those with business printing requirements—to ensure efficiency, reliability, and mobility. With the customised solution offered by BroPlan, customers pay only for what they need, which means they benefit from substantial savings on the most suitable package for their business.
